8.    Retirement Plans:


The Company sponsors a Defined Benefit Retirement Plan for its employees and records net periodic pension benefit / cost pro rata throughout the year. The following table provides the components of net periodic pension benefit cost for the plan for the three and six -months ended June 30, 2013 and 2012 including the required and expected contributions:

During the three and six-months ended June 30, 2013, the Company did not make any contribution to the plan. The Company does not have a minimum required contribution for the December 31, 2013 plan year, and is not expecting to make a contribution for the related plan year.
